Hello 

Here is my current problem child a NEC IVS 2000 with an E1 ISDN PRI in
Uruguay. 

Attached is the router configuration. 

The customer states that they can only select a few options. Here they
are:

NEC IVS2000 with a 30 PRTA board .

Command 3518 No Digit Conversion

                3589 NO CRC (Cyclic Redundancy Check)

                3502 Bothway route

                AA06 ETSI

                3002 ISDN Trunks

                3003 ISDN Trunks

The situation as it stands right now is that the customer in Uruguay can
make and complete calls to Miami.

But Miami cannot complete calls to Uruguay. We get the debug error
"Cause i = 0x81AC - Requested circuit/channel not available".

Here is the rub in the situation, while the Uruguay end is a PBX the
Miami end is a CCM. I have no configuration on the Miami end,

since it is pointed directly to the CCM from Uruguay. This type of
arrangement is currently working for another customer in South America

with a different vendor's pbx. But mostly the same configuration. 

What is wrong and how do I correct it? I am sure it is my mistake,
mostly because I am fairly new at this and have not had a full range of
experience.
